Assistant Registrar Grade 2

Closes 13 Apr 2025
Full Time

We are seeking a highly experienced Assistant Registrar to join our dynamic teams at the Powerhouse. This role undertakes registration activities for medium to large-scale exhibitions, including logistics, producing and maintaining documentation, managing the collection database, and installing objects. The Assistant Registrar assists with implementing Museum policies, processes, and procedures related to inward and outward loan management, collection administration, stores and logistics, object handling and documentation, exhibition support, and archives management.

Workshop Preparator

Closes 13 Apr 2025
Full Time

The Workshop Preparator role is crucial in ensuring the successful delivery of exhibitions and programs across all Powerhouse sites, including Ultimo, Parramatta, Castle Hill, Sydney Observatory and external venue partners. Working within the multidisciplinary Production Workshop team, the Preparator role primarily involves the construction, fabrication, and installation of exhibitions, Object mounts, art installations, collection displays, and other museum projects in line with international conservation practices.

Powerhouse and David Jones Australian Design Commission

Powerhouse and David Jones have established an annual Australian Design Commission. This partnership aims to invest into the next generation of Australian designers by providing them with the opportunity to design a prototype of a new product for the contemporary Australian home.

Visitor Experience Volunteer

Volunteers play a significant role in enhancing the visitor experience at Powerhouse Ultimo, Sydney Observatory and Powerhouse Castle Hill. They actively promote visitor engagement by initiating conversations, narrating stories in the exhibitions, collaborating in guided tours and facilitating interactive activities.
